首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CSS:如何让div在内容改变时不再缩小高度

CSS是层叠样式表(Cascading Style Sheets)的缩写,是一种用来控制网页样式和布局的标记语言。在前端开发中,CSS起到控制网页元素外观和布局的作用。

对于如何让div在内容改变时不再缩小高度,可以使用CSS的属性来实现。具体有以下几种方法:

  1. 使用min-height属性:设置div的最小高度,这样无论内容多少,div都不会缩小到小于最小高度。 示例代码:
代码语言:txt
复制
div {
  min-height: 100px;
}
  1. 使用overflow属性:设置div的溢出处理方式为自动(auto)或隐藏(hidden),当内容超过div的高度时,可以自动显示滚动条或隐藏溢出部分。 示例代码:
代码语言:txt
复制
div {
  height: 100px;
  overflow: auto; /* 或 hidden */
}
  1. 使用display属性和table布局:将div的display属性设置为table,然后使用table-cell布局,这样div会根据内容的多少自动调整高度。 示例代码:
代码语言:txt
复制
div {
  display: table;
}
  1. 使用flex布局:将div的display属性设置为flex,然后使用flex-grow属性来设置内容区域的伸缩比例,这样内容变多时,div会自动增长高度。 示例代码:
代码语言:txt
复制
div {
  display: flex;
  flex-grow: 1;
}

以上是几种常用的方法来实现让div在内容改变时不再缩小高度的效果。根据具体情况选择适合的方法即可。

腾讯云相关产品和产品介绍链接地址:由于要求答案中不能提及腾讯云以外的品牌商,无法给出具体产品和链接。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券